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!
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.
Do tej pory korzystałem z wersji [i]libcairo2[/i] z patchem [i]cleartype[/i] z tego repo:
*** 1.8.10-6.1 991 600 file:/usr/local/portage/ stuff/ Packages 980 http://hadret.rootnode.net/debian/ unstable/main amd64 Packages 100 /var/lib/dpkg/status
i taki stan rzeczy jak najbardziej mi odpowiadał. :)
========
Powoli jednak obowiązującą wersją [i]Cairo[/i] staje się wersja 1.10*, a tu już nie jest tak dobrze...
Do wyboru są następujące:
libcairo2: Zainstalowana: 1.8.10-6.1 Kandydująca: 1.8.10-6.1 Sposób przypięcia: 1.8.10-6.1 Tabela wersji: 1.10.2-2 991 980 http://ftp.pl.debian.org/debian/ unstable/main amd64 Packages 1.10.2-1.1 991 400 http://hadret.rootnode.net/debian/ experimental/main amd64 Packages 1.10.2-1.1 991 300 http://mozilla.debian.net/ experimental/iceweasel-4.0 amd64 Packages 1.10.2-1 991 400 http://ftp.pl.debian.org/debian/ experimental/main amd64 Packages 1.10.0-1ubuntu2 991 500 http://packages.linuxmint.com/ debian/import amd64 Packages *** 1.8.10-6.1 991 600 file:/usr/local/portage/ stuff/ Packages 980 http://hadret.rootnode.net/debian/ unstable/main amd64 Packages 100 /var/lib/dpkg/status 1.8.10-6 991 500 http://ftp.pl.debian.org/debian/ stable/main amd64 Packages 500 http://ftp.pl.debian.org/debian/ testing/main amd64 Packages
Przetestowałem po kolei wszystkie te wersje 1.10* i nie widzę między nimi żadnej różnicy (znaczy na każdej czcionki wyglądają paskudnie, oczywiście to kwestia gustu, jednak dla mnie liczy się mój gust :P). Różnicę natomiast robi doinstalowanie pakietów:
aptitude install fontconfig-config=2.8.0-2ubuntu1 libfontconfig1=2.8.0-2ubuntu1
Te wersje dostępne są w repozytorium Minta dla Debiana, ale chyba pochodzą prosto z Ubuntu. ;) Po takim zabiegu jest lepiej, jednak i tak o wiele gorzej niż na wspomnianym na początku [i]libcairo2[/i] z patchem [i]cleartype[/i]. Obecnie zatem wróciłem do tego starego [i]libcairo2[/i], jednak jest to rozwiązanie tymczasowe... wersja 1.10* jest już w [i]unstable[/i], niedługo pewnie trafi do [i]testinga[/i], prędzej czy później oprogramowanie z repozytorium będzie miało w zależnościach wersję 1.10* ([i]xulrunner-2.0[/i] już ma) i system zacznie mi się rozjeżdżać...
Da się jakoś uzyskać na [i]Cairo[/i] 1.10 taki efekt jak na 1.8 z patchem [i]cleartype[/i]?
Mam nadzieję, że ktoś tu ogarnia ten temat, bo ja już pierdolca przy tym dostaję. ;)
Offline
Nie chcę ciebie załamywać ale walczyłem z tym w ch.. czasu, przeryłem kilkadziesiąt stron i nic. Przez te głupie czcionki zrezygnowałem z Debiana i nie wrócę do czasu aż coś w tej kwestii się nie zmieni. Ważniejsze dla mnie są moje oczy a czytanie z niewyraźnych czcionek do przyjemnych nie należy.
EDIT: Też używałem fontconfig z Ubuntu dzięki czemu czcionki nabrały troszkę lepszego kształtu ale nie wszędzie, i już na pewno nie w Evince.
Ostatnio edytowany przez k4misiek (2011-02-08 19:51:55)
Offline
Zobacz na to moze sie przyda http://hadret.rootnode.net
Offline
[b]ArnVaker[/b], możesz pokazać jak obecnie wyglądają u Ciebie czcionki?
U mnie na domyślnych paczkach jest tak:
[url=http://img109.imageshack.us/i/zrzutekranu1yf.png/][img]http://img109.imageshack.us/img109/3663/zrzutekranu1yf.th.png[/img][/url]
Offline
A może weźmiesz zródła cairo z patchami z Gentoo, i skompilujesz do paczki deb?
Bo w tej chwili mam tą wersję:
qlist -IvU x11-libs/cairo x11-libs/cairo-1.10.2-r1 (X opengl qt4 static-libs svg xcb)
Dla tej wersji w ogóle nie ma flagi cleartype, ale wygląda na to, że ma ten patch już wpakowany na stałe.
Po aktualizacji z wersji 1.08 z cleartype, wygląd czcionek nie zmienił się w żaden sposób.
A jedna paczka w repo Duga się zmieści ;)
Pozdrawiam
;-)
Offline
[b]@k4misiek[/b]
:(
[b]@debianus_userus[/b]
Repozytorium [b]Hadreta[/b] znam, właśnie stamtąd mam [i]libcairo2[/i] z patchem [i]cleartype[/i]. Jednak w przypadku wersji 1.10* (również z jego repozytorium) nie działa to już tak dobrze. Podałem to w sumie w pierwszym poście. ;)
[b]@Tomeku[/b]
1.8 z patchem [i]cleartype[/i]:
[url=http://ompldr.org/vN2NmbQ][img]http://ompldr.org/tN2NmbQ[/img][/url] [url=http://ompldr.org/vN2Nmbw][img]http://ompldr.org/tN2Nmbw[/img][/url]
1.10 (którykolwiek):
[url=http://ompldr.org/vN2NmcA][img]http://ompldr.org/tN2NmcA[/img][/url] [url=http://ompldr.org/vN2NmcQ][img]http://ompldr.org/tN2NmcQ[/img][/url]
1.10 + [i]fontconfig[/i] z Ubuntu:
[url=http://ompldr.org/vN2Nmcw][img]http://ompldr.org/tN2Nmcw[/img][/url] [url=http://ompldr.org/vN2NmdQ][img]http://ompldr.org/tN2NmdQ[/img][/url]
[b]@Jacekalex[/b]
Na Gentoo używałem tylko wersji 1.8, także jeszcze pewnie obadam jak to wygląda na 1.10. :)
Offline
Wg mnie te z fontconfigiem z ubuntu wyglądają najlepiej.
Offline
[b]@Marvell[/b]
Na screenach z DUG-a IMO 1.8 z [i]cleartype[/i] oraz 1.10 z [i]fontconfig[/i] Ubuntu wyglądają prawie tak samo.
Na tych drugich screenach te z 1.10 + [i]fontconfig[/i] Ubuntu wyglądają jednak o wiele gorzej... Nie wiem od czego to zależy. ;)
=========================
Wersja 1.10 na Gentoo też ssie...
1.8 + [i]cleartype[/i]:
[url=http://ompldr.org/vN2NpOA][img]http://ompldr.org/tN2NpOA[/img][/url] [url=http://ompldr.org/vN2NpYQ][img]http://ompldr.org/tN2NpYQ[/img][/url]
1.10 z flagami takimi jak [b]Jacekalex[/b]:
[url=http://ompldr.org/vN2NpYw][img]http://ompldr.org/tN2NpYw[/img][/url] [url=http://ompldr.org/vN2NpZA][img]http://ompldr.org/tN2NpZA[/img][/url]
Offline
ArnVaker: znaczy te z 1.8, które są delikatnie rozmazane w porównaniu z 1.10, Tobie najbardziej odpowiadają? Z ciekawości pytam.
Między 1.10 a 1.10-ubuntu różnica jest nieznaczna, zauważalna chyba tylko przy takich porównaniach — myślę że wzrok bardzo szybko się do obu może przyzwyczaić.
Ja muszę przyznać, że na fonty w Debianie jakoś nigdy nie zwróciłem szczególnej uwagi. Te domyślne są całkiem ok. Nie wydają mi się ani jakieś poszarpane ani rozmyte. Nie męczy mnie wielogodzinne korzystanie z komputera, a to najważniejsze.
Offline
[quote=Minio]ArnVaker: znaczy te z 1.8, które są delikatnie rozmazane w porównaniu z 1.10, Tobie najbardziej odpowiadają? Z ciekawości pytam.[/quote]
Tak. Jak mówiłem — kwestia gustu. Pewnie też jeszcze monitora... Mnie te czyste debianowe do szału doprowadzają. ;)
Offline
Arni, jaką masz rozdzielczość czcionek i wyświetlacz?
Bo ja używam monitora CRT, czcionki 125 pikseli i działają ok.
natomiast jak szukałem po sklepach jakiegoś monitora LCD, to wszystko, co widziałem w okolicy, wyświetlało nie czcionki, tylko pokazywało jakąś kaszanę zamiast czcionek.
Ale po tanich matrycach wiele się spodziewać nie można.
Właśnie dlatego (w lapkach raczej trudne ;) ) ale wolę jakiegoś grata z allegro, niż wspaniały LCD.
Przed świętami zdechła mi Iiyama, mam teraz chwilowo LG 17'' - za 20 zł, i działa, czcionki wyświetla.
Więc może te czcionki, to problem LCD, i trzeba pokombinować z innymi ustawieniami?
Pozdrawiam
;-)
Offline
Nie mam zamiaru zmieniać monitora z powodu aktualizacji [i]Cairo[/i] w Debianie.
Pytanie brzmi:
[quote=ArnVaker]Da się jakoś uzyskać na [i]Cairo[/i] 1.10 taki efekt jak na 1.8 z patchem [i]cleartype[/i]?[/quote]
Offline
Ja nie pytam, czy chcesz zmieniać, ja pytam, co by poszukać, jak się preparuje fonty pod konkretny wyświetlacz.
Bo mam tu też Squeeze, i ma fonty ok.
A znam jedną firmę, gdzie używają Drayteków crt - bo koszmarnie drogi program księgowy na LCD jest nieczytelny.
Offline
Dla jednego będą ok, a dla innego nie. Gdyby wszystko dało się uzyskać ustawieniami, to patche w stylu [i]cleartype[/i] w ogóle by nie powstały.
Pytanie jest konkretne:
[quote=ArnVaker]Da się jakoś uzyskać na [i]Cairo[/i] 1.10 taki efekt jak na 1.8 z patchem [i]cleartype[/i]?[/quote]
Offline
Może to was zainteresuje, ustawienia dają całkiem niezły efekt: http://forums.gentoo.org/viewtopic-p-6183606.html#6183606
A tu strona z ciekawymi patchami: http://www.infinality.net/blog/ (nie testowałem).
Offline
A ja radzę sprawdzić, ile można uzyskać kombinując z rozdzielczością i innymi ustawieniami czcionek.
Gentoo:
takie flagi dla cairo:
$ qlist -IvU cairo dev-cpp/cairomm-1.8.2 (svg) dev-python/pycairo-1.8.10 (svg) dev-ruby/rcairo-1.8.5-r1 (ruby_targets_ruby18) x11-libs/cairo-1.10.2-r1 (X opengl qt4 static-libs svg xcb) x11-libs/libsvg-cairo-0.1.6
cleartype ani śladu, ale czcionki są w miarę ok.
A jak wyglądają - zrzut ekranu:
[url=http://jacekalex.sh.dug.net.pl/czcionki.png][img]http://jacekalex.sh.dug.net.pl/czcionki2.png[/img][/url]
Jako, że to printscreen - monitor raczej tu nie robi różnicy.
Pozdrawiam
;-)
Offline
Jaki czas temu wyczytałem, że cairo1.10+ ma domyślnie włączony lcdfilter, tylko dlaczego w Gentoo działa a w Debianie już nie bardzo? Udało komuś się coś zrobić z tymi nieszczęsnymi czcionkami?
Offline
w ~/.fonts dodaj:
<match target="font"> <edit name="rgba" mode="assign"><const>rgb</const></edit> <edit name="autohint" mode="assign"><bool>false</bool></edit> <edit name="antialias" mode="assign"><bool>true</bool></edit> <edit name="hinting" mode="assign"><bool>true</bool></edit> <edit name="hintstyle" mode="assign"><const>hintfull</const></edit> <edit name="lcdfilter" mode="assign"><const>lcddefault</const></edit> </match>
I lcdfilter powinien działać.
Ja sobie skompilowałem i spakietowałem (byle jak, ale jest) freetype 2.4.4 z patchami z tej strony: http://www.infinality.net/blog/ , wykorzystałem także fonts.conf od tej osoby z małymi modyfikacjami. Według mnie osiągnąłem niezły efekt wygładzonych czcionek w całym systemie (Iceweasel, KDE, LibreOffice i programy oparte o GTK).
A wygląda to tak:
[url=http://img513.imageshack.us/i/czcionkiy.png/][img]http://img513.imageshack.us/img513/5796/czcionkiy.th.png[/img][/url]
Ostatnio edytowany przez Tomeku (2011-02-15 01:51:29)
Offline
Możesz jeszcze pokazać screeena z Evince i poniższym plikiem?
http://www.cs.otago.ac.nz/staffpriv/mike/Papers/MinMaxHeaps/MinMaxHeaps.pdf
Offline
Ale zależności pociągnął ten program :/
[url=http://img24.imageshack.us/i/pdfe.png/][img]http://img24.imageshack.us/img24/7074/pdfe.th.png[/img][/url]
Ogólnie nie wiem czy to wina GTK 3.0 które mi zassała razem z tym programem, ale Okular (po lewej) ładniej renderuje czcionki.
Offline
I tę stronę jeszcze: [url]https://alioth.debian.org/scm/viewvc.php/announcements/pl/2011/2011-02-06-squeeze-announce.wml?view=markup&root=publicity[/url] :)
Ten wątek na forum Gentoo to już jakiś [i]hardcore[/i]. ;) Miałem nadzieję, że w Debianie obejdzie się bez własnoręcznej kompilacji czegokolwiek i ustawiania wszystkiego w pliku tekstowym... Sam [u]jeszcze[/u] nie robiłem kolejnego podejścia, na tym starym [deb]libcairo2[/deb] siedzę póki mogę.
Offline
Z niektórymi czcionkami jest jeszcze problem, w sumie z literami w niektórych czcionkach, np. tutaj pochyłe "[i]z[/i]" w nicku azhag'a nie za ładnie wygląda (co to za czcionka?). Ale z tego co widzę po twoich screenach to i tak masz inne czcionki ustawione.
[url=http://img830.imageshack.us/i/arnc.png/][img]http://img830.imageshack.us/img830/1857/arnc.th.png[/img][/url]
Offline
[quote=Tomeku]np. tutaj pochyłe "[i]z[/i]" w nicku azhag'a nie za ładnie wygląda (co to za czcionka?)[/quote]
Taka, jaką masz ustawioną w przeglądarce.
[img]http://dug.net.pl/~azhag/czcionka_azhaga.png[/img]
Offline
Czyli co, taki ja na przykład mogę zrobić, żeby te czcionki wyglądały jak Jack pokazał w poście nr... #16, bo mnie już krew zalła dawano, a żadne grzebania w ustawieniach czy to przeglądarki czy systemowych guzik dają:
Mam tak:
marg1@gentoo ~ $ qlist -IvU cairo dev-python/pycairo-1.8.10 (svg) x11-libs/cairo-1.10.2-r1 (X opengl qt4 static-libs svg xcb)
Mało trochę:)
Teraz nan tak :)
arg1@gentoo ~ $ qlist -IvU cairo dev-cpp/cairomm-1.9.8 (svg) dev-python/pycairo-1.8.10 (svg) dev-ruby/rcairo-1.10.0-r2 (ruby_targets_ruby18) x11-libs/cairo-1.10.2-r1 (X opengl qt4 static-libs svg xcb) x11-libs/libsvg-cairo-0.1.6
I co dobrze :) po czym poznać, że dobrze? Może jakiś restart X
Ja pier.. ale się polepszyło :)
Naprawdę się polepszyło, chyba sobie tego nie wmawiam :)
Godzinę czasu przestawiałem czcionki w FF aż doszedłem do wniosku, że najlepsza jest DejaVuSerif 12 :)
Doszedłem mniej więcej do ideału:
[url=http://img543.imageshack.us/i/dug2.jpg/][img]http://img543.imageshack.us/img543/8608/dug2.th.jpg[/img][/url]
Doszedłem mniej więcej do ideału:
New Century Schoolbook 16 120 dpi wygładzanie średnie, dlatego taka duża bo mam duży monitor i nie widzę jak mam 12 na nim :)
Ostatnio edytowany przez marg1 (2011-02-16 09:52:23)
Offline
Ja mam zainstalowanego Debiana Squeeze i zauważyłem pewną prawidłowość: w Firefoxie (zainstalowany z repo Minta) wyświetlanie czcionek jest zdecydowanie gorsze niż w Chromium. Ustawiłem te same kroje czcionek w obu przeglądarkach. W Firefoxie są "ostre" natomiast w Chromium "lekko rozmyte".
Offline
Time (s) | Query |
---|---|
0.00009 | SET CHARSET latin2 |
0.00004 | SET NAMES latin2 |
0.00123 | SELECT u.*, g.*, o.logged FROM punbb_users AS u INNER JOIN punbb_groups AS g ON u.group_id=g.g_id LEFT JOIN punbb_online AS o ON o.ident='18.118.119.129' WHERE u.id=1 |
0.00086 | REPLACE INTO punbb_online (user_id, ident, logged) VALUES(1, '18.118.119.129', 1732234311) |
0.00051 | SELECT * FROM punbb_online WHERE logged<1732234011 |
0.00075 | SELECT topic_id FROM punbb_posts WHERE id=165570 |
0.00006 | SELECT id FROM punbb_posts WHERE topic_id=18265 ORDER BY posted |
0.00030 | SELECT t.subject, t.closed, t.num_replies, t.sticky, f.id AS forum_id, f.forum_name, f.moderators, fp.post_replies, 0 FROM punbb_topics AS t INNER JOIN punbb_forums AS f ON f.id=t.forum_id LEFT JOIN punbb_forum_perms AS fp ON (fp.forum_id=f.id AND fp.group_id=3) WHERE (fp.read_forum IS NULL OR fp.read_forum=1) AND t.id=18265 AND t.moved_to IS NULL |
0.00021 | SELECT search_for, replace_with FROM punbb_censoring |
0.00367 | SELECT u.email, u.title, u.url, u.location, u.use_avatar, u.signature, u.email_setting, u.num_posts, u.registered, u.admin_note, p.id, p.poster AS username, p.poster_id, p.poster_ip, p.poster_email, p.message, p.hide_smilies, p.posted, p.edited, p.edited_by, g.g_id, g.g_user_title, o.user_id AS is_online FROM punbb_posts AS p INNER JOIN punbb_users AS u ON u.id=p.poster_id INNER JOIN punbb_groups AS g ON g.g_id=u.group_id LEFT JOIN punbb_online AS o ON (o.user_id=u.id AND o.user_id!=1 AND o.idle=0) WHERE p.topic_id=18265 ORDER BY p.id LIMIT 0,25 |
0.00125 | UPDATE punbb_topics SET num_views=num_views+1 WHERE id=18265 |
Total query time: 0.00897 s |